    Cold Steel MAA Wing Spear 95MW
    Jun 21, 2016
    A Big Badass Spear !
    The Cold Steel MAA Wing Spear is a Wicked Weapon indeed! It's over 7 feet long and two feet of that is the Spearhead. Though the weight is manageable, this is not a Spear meant for throwing and I wouldn't actually use it any Battle re-enactment-it's potentially way too deadly. The Spearhead is very sharp and could be used as a small Sword if left unattached from the shaft, which is made from a strong,nicely finished wood-almost too pretty. It doesn't come with a Cover for Spearhead, which I would definitely recommend for Safety's sake, but a Large Dagger's Sheath might Accommodate it-or do a little Leather Work. It is pretty Awesome for what it is-but it is definitely NOT a Toy!
    Berserkers: A Viking Saga, New DVD, Harry Feltham, Nick Cornwall, Simon Armstron
    Dec 11, 2015
    Neither the Best nor the Worst
    Viking the Berserkers is a well made film-no major stars and the budget doesn't really figure into it since it's basically filmed outside-but it holds one's attention. I don't agree with "Den of Geek's" cover blurb about being "All Action" and "Gore Soaked"-It's neither, although there is action and bloodshed in this unrated offering. Basically it's a pursuit film with drug crazed Vikings hunting young Saxons for a Ritual Sacrifice-until the Saxon's decide to fight back. All performances are acceptable and the action scenes are engaging enough with a good sense of realism pervading and professional quality-filmmaking apparent throughout. For a low budget production, it's a very decent movie and definitely watchable.
